In short, Seinfeld season 7, read more:
"The Engagement"[4] Andy Ackerman Larry David September
21, 1995 111
Elaine has a problem sleeping in her new apartment because
of a nearby constantly barking dog. Kramer, Newman and Elaine
commit a dognapping scene and take the dog far out of the
city. George gets back with Susan Ross, his former girlfriend
from NBC and he asks her to marry him. Jerry breaks up with
his girlfriend again.
"The Postponement" Andy Ackerman Larry David September
28, 1995 112
Elaine's dog problem is solved by a neighborly rabbi with
a cable show. Kramer's involvement in the dognapping worries
him. George decides he wants to postpone the engagement. Kramer
and Jerry try to see "Plan 9 From Outer Space",
Kramer sneaks in gourmet coffee, spills it and says he has
a legal case.
"The Maestro" Andy Ackerman Larry David October
6, 1995 113
George decides that he needs to help a security guard that
works at her uncle's store. Elaine begins dating the "Maestro."
Kramer's gets an out of court settlement in his lawsuit nets
him free coffee at any location around the world." Jerry
asks Poppy about Tuscany and is referred to Poppy's cousin,
who makes him an offer he can't refuse.
"The Wink" Andy Ackerman Tom Gammill & Max Pross
October 12, 1995 114
Elaine dates the man from her wake-up service. A bit of grapefruit
pulp, from Jerry's breakfast, gets into George's eye and causes
problems for him when his winks keep getting misinterpreted.
Jerry's healthy diet conflicts with his dating of Elaine's
cousin. Kramer promises a sick boy that Yankee Paul O'Neill
will hit two home runs for him, so he can get back a birthday
card that he sold based on George's wink.
"The Hot Tub" Andy Ackerman Gregg Kavet & Andy
Robin October 26, 1995 115
George picks up a bad habit from some visiting Astros representatives.
During the time of the New York City Marathon, Elaine has
an out of country runner as her house guest. The runner had
overslept and missed the big race at the last Olympics and
Jerry obsesses with ensuring that it doesn't happen again.
Kramer installs a hot tub in his apartment.
"The Soup Nazi" Andy Ackerman Spike Feresten November
2, 1995 116
Elaine finds an antique armoire she wants. George makes a
mistake while trying to get his soup from the "Soup Nazi."
George and Elaine discuss how annoyed they are by Jerry's
sweet-talking with his current girlfriend, especially their
calling each other "Schmoopie". Elaine makes an
ordering error in front of the "Soup Nazi," and
is banned for a year. Susan appreciates that George is finally
showing his feelings in public.
"The Secret Code" Andy Ackerman Alec Berg &
Jeff Schaffer November 9, 1995 117
George refuses to tell his ATM code ("Bosco") to
Susan. Elaine dates an amnesiac. Leapin' Larry, wants Jerry
to do spots for his store, but he is angered when he thinks
Jerry is doing an impression of him when his foot falls asleep.
Kramer gets an emergency band scanner and decides to help
at the FDNY. Elaine doesn't want to go on a date with her
boss, J. Peterman, so she leaves Jerry and George at the restaurant.
George's code is needed in a life or death situation.
"The Pool Guy" Andy Ackerman David Mandel November
16, 1995 118
Elaine befriends Susan. Jerry meets his pool guy outside a
movie, and then he can't get rid of him. George is worried
by Elaine wanting to get to know Susan. Kramer's new phone
number is similar to a film information line. When Kramer
keeps getting wrong numbers, he begins giving out the information
for movie show times a la "Moviefone".
"The Sponge" Andy Ackerman Peter Mehlman December
7, 1995 119
Jerry gets a girl's number on Kramer's AIDS walk list. Elaine
must decide whether her current boyfriend is "spongeworthy."
George tells Susan the secret of the size of Jerry's jeans.
George is "out of the loop." Kramer refuses to "wear
an AIDS ribbon."
"The Gum" Andy Ackerman Tom Gammill & Max Pross
December 14, 1995 120
Kramer is active in the re-opening of an old movie theater.
George's friend Lloyd Braun has a pack of Chinese gum that
Kramer insists everyone tries. Elaine accidentally "reveals
herself" to Lloyd. Jerry must wear glasses while around
Lloyd. George's girlfriend Deena thinks he is showing signs
of being on the verge of a breakdown.
"The Rye" Andy Ackerman Carol Leifer January 4,
1996 121
Elaine dates a jazz saxophonist. Jerry tells one of the band
members the saxophonist and Elaine are "hot and heavy."
Susan's parents meet and have dinner with the Costanzas for
the first time. Both families obsess over a loaf of rye bread
that wasn't served with the meal, which Frank takes back home.
Kramer takes over a friend's horse-drawn carriage for a week
and feeds the horse Beef-a-Reeno.
"The Caddy" Andy Ackerman Gregg Kavet & Andy
Robin January 25, 1996 122
Kramer befriends a caddy, who helps him to improve his golf
game and offer him other advice. When George leaves his car
at work, Wilhelm and Steinbrenner think he has been working
overtime. Elaine meets an old high-school friend who is now
an heiress to the Oh Henry! candy bar fortune and a "braless
wonder" (Brenda Strong). Kramer and Elaine take her rival
to court and only Jerry may stand in the way.
"The Seven" Andy Ackerman Alec Berg & Jeff Schaffer
February 1, 1996 123
Elaine strains her neck trying to get a bike down from the
wall. In pain she promises the bike to whoever fixes her neck.
Kramer saves the day and wants the bike. George is angry when
Susan's cousin chooses to name her baby with the name he planned
to give his first offspring. Kramer works out an arrangement
with Jerry to keep track of what he takes from Jerry's kitchen.
Jerry girlfriend's always wears the same dress.
"The Cadillac, Part 1" Andy Ackerman Larry David
& Jerry Seinfeld February 8, 1996 124
Jerry surprises his parents by buying them a new Cadillac
which Elaine becomes infatuated with Jerry as a result. The
cable company wants to meet with Kramer. George reconsiders
his engagement when one of Elaine's friends suggests that
he meets with actress, Marisa Tomei. Jack Klompus accuses
Morty of embezzling funds to pay for his new Cadillac.
"The Cadillac, Part 2" Andy Ackerman Larry David
& Jerry Seinfeld February 8, 1996 125
Kramer continues to mess with the cable guy. George's obsession
with Marisa Tomei makes Susan suspicious. George receives
Marisa's phone number and must now create an alibi involving
her "boyfriend" Art Vandelay. Morty's only testimony
is from the woman that Jerry stole the marble rye from to
prevent him from impeachment. Susan thinks George is having
an affair with Elaine.
"The Shower Head" Andy Ackerman Peter Mehlman &
Marjorie Gross February 15, 1996 126
Kramer and Jerry are not pleased with the new low flow shower
heads that the buildings maintenance people have put in for
them. Elaine is surprised to find out that she has tested
positive for Opium. Jerry is frustrated by the fact that his
parents aren't moving back to Florida and George is elated
because his parents are considering moving to Florida.
"The Doll" Andy Ackerman Tom Gammill & Max Pross
February 22, 1996 127
Susan's old roommate gives Jerry a package that she wants
him to be careful with. Frank turns George's room into a billiard
room and Kramer challenges him to a game of billiards where
the space is a bit tight. Jerry is enthusiastic about a new
toothbrush. Susan has a doll that looks like George's mother.
Elaine tries to replace an autographed picture of "the
other guy," for "the Maestro" that was damaged
while they were in Tuscany.
"The Friars Club" Andy Ackerman David Mandel March
7, 1996 128
George successfully delays his wedding. Jerry goes out with
Susan's best friend. Jerry loses a jacket he "borrowed"
for dinner at the Friars Club. Kramer tries to duplicate the
sleeping patterns of Da Vinci. Peterman hires a deaf employee
(Rob Schneider) and Elaine suffers the consequences, when
she gets loaded with most of his work.
"The Wig Master" Andy Ackerman Spike Feresten March
16, 1996 129
Jerry uses Elaine to prove that a sales clerk is wrong about
his looking at an expensive jacket. Elaine is picked up by
the clerk after he leads her on with the promise of a big
discount. George has an unwanted house guest. George discovers
why a parking lot is so cheap, when he finds a used condom
in his car. Kramer becomes a "pimp."
"The Calzone" Andy Ackerman Alec Berg & Jeff
Schaffer April 25, 1996 130
George becomes Steinbrenner's pet, when he shares an eggplant
calzone with him. Kramer is raving about wearing clothes "straight
out of the dryer." Elaine's boyfriend is dating her without
really ever asking her out. Jerry takes advantage of his girlfriend's
ability to get anything she wants. Kramer starts using an
oven for his clothing.
"The Bottle Deposit, Part 1" Andy Ackerman Gregg
Kavet & Andy Robin May 2, 1996 131
George doesn't hear the details on an important project that
Wilhelm wants him to champion. Elaine gets into a bidding
war at an auction with Sue Ellen Mischke over a set of golf
clubs owned by JFK, the Oh Henry! candy heiress. Consequently,
she spends a bit more than she was authorized by Peterman.
Kramer collects used pop bottles and cans so he can take them
to Michigan where the refund is doubled. Jerry takes his car
to a fanatical car care mechanic (Brad Garrett). Jerry's car
is stolen by the mechanic.
"The Bottle Deposit, Part 2" Andy Ackerman Gregg
Kavet & Andy Robin May 2, 1996 132
Wilhelm is delighted with the job George did on the project;
however, he has no idea what he did or how he did it. Kramer
spots Jerry's car in Ohio. George is sent to a mental hospital
by Steinbrenner. Newman finds a farmer's house, complete with
the proverbial daughter.
"The Wait Out" Andy Ackerman Peter Mehlman May 9,
1996 133
George makes an off-hand remark to a married couple with a
rocky relationship, leading to their breakup. Elaine starts
driving again and almost makes Jerry sick. Kramer starts wearing
jeans that are too tight that he cannot get them off. Elaine
and Jerry make plans to move in on the separated couple.
"The Invitations" Andy Ackerman Larry David May
16, 1996 134
George tries to think of a way out of his relationship with
Susan, Elaine suggests smoking and Kramer suggests a pre-nuptial
agreement. Jerry nearly gets hit by a car but is saved by
his female equivalent, Jeannie. Jerry thinks he is in love
with Jeannie and proposes to her. Kramer tries to cash in
on a bank's offer of a $100 if one of their tellers doesn't
say hello. Susan passes out while licking envelopes.
